Applications of  water bath heater circulator

Applications of water bath heater circulator

Both in commercial and school settings, the water bath heater circulator provides stable heat for experiments that necessitate temperature-driven conditions. It is used in processes such as protein digestion, bacterial culture, and heating of reagents. The water bath heater circulator is also crucial in environmental analysis where accuracy in temperature control of incubating samples is needed. The water bath heater circulator' reliability supports laboratories in conducting standard experiments as well as complex research studies. The water bath heater circulator' stable performance ensures reproducibility and reliability, boosting laboratory results' credibility across various fields.

Care & Maintenance of water bath heater circulator

Care & Maintenance of water bath heater circulator

Maintenance of water bath heater circulator involves periodic cleaning and inspection cycles. Unplug the device and let it cool down completely. Clean the interior using non-abrasive cleaning materials to prevent scratching. Use deionized water to limit mineral deposition and maximize heating efficiency. Check for rust or deposition on metal components. Ensure the temperature sensor is covered up to the hilt in use. FAQ

  • Q: Can a water bath be used for enzyme incubation? A: Yes, water baths are frequently used for enzyme incubation, as they provide precise and stable temperature conditions necessary for biological reactions.

    Q: How does a digital water bath differ from an analog one? A: A digital water bath offers programmable controls and precise temperature readings, while analog models rely on manual adjustments and thermometers.

    Q: What maintenance steps extend the life of a water bath? A: Regular cleaning, using distilled water, checking the thermostat, and drying the chamber after use all help maintain performance.

    Q: Why do some water baths have lids or covers? A: Lids help reduce heat loss, prevent contamination, and minimize evaporation, maintaining consistent internal temperatures.

    Q: What should be done if a water bath fails to heat properly? A: Inspect the power supply, thermostat, and heating element; if the issue persists, discontinue use until professional servicing is performed.
